- Corporate Finance: Learn how companies make financial decisions, manage their capital structure, and allocate resources to maximize shareholder value. This course covers topics such as capital budgeting, dividend policy, and mergers and acquisitions. You'll develop the skills to analyze financial statements, assess investment opportunities, and make informed recommendations to management. This knowledge is essential for anyone pursuing a career in corporate finance, investment banking, or consulting.
- Investments: Explore the world of investment management, including asset allocation, security analysis, and portfolio construction. This course covers topics such as stock valuation, bond pricing, and derivative instruments. You'll learn how to analyze financial data, assess risk, and construct portfolios that meet specific investment objectives. This knowledge is essential for anyone pursuing a career in investment management, wealth management, or financial analysis.
- Financial Markets: Understand the structure and function of financial markets, including money markets, capital markets, and derivatives markets. This course covers topics such as market microstructure, trading strategies, and regulatory issues. You'll learn how financial markets operate, how prices are determined, and how market participants interact. This knowledge is essential for anyone pursuing a career in trading, sales, or research in the financial industry.
- Programming Fundamentals: Learn the basics of programming, including data types, control structures, and functions. This course will teach you how to write code in a high-level programming language such as Python or Java. You'll develop the skills to solve problems using code and create simple software applications. This is the foundation for all other computer science courses.
- Data Structures and Algorithms: Explore the fundamental data structures and algorithms used in computer science. This course covers topics such as arrays, linked lists, trees, graphs, sorting, and searching. You'll learn how to choose the right data structure and algorithm for a particular problem and how to analyze their performance. This knowledge is essential for developing efficient and scalable software applications.
- Software Engineering: Learn the principles and practices of software engineering, including requirements analysis, design, implementation, testing, and maintenance. This course will teach you how to develop large-scale software systems using a systematic and disciplined approach. You'll also learn about software development methodologies such as Agile and Waterfall. This knowledge is essential for anyone pursuing a career in software development.
- Financial Modeling: Learn how to build financial models using spreadsheets and programming languages. This course covers topics such as discounted cash flow analysis, sensitivity analysis, and scenario planning. You'll develop the skills to create financial models for valuing companies, analyzing investments, and forecasting financial performance. This knowledge is essential for anyone pursuing a career in investment banking, private equity, or corporate finance.
- Algorithmic Trading: Explore the world of automated trading systems, including market microstructure, order execution, and risk management. This course covers topics such as high-frequency trading, statistical arbitrage, and machine learning. You'll learn how to develop and implement trading algorithms that can automatically execute trades based on predefined rules. This knowledge is essential for anyone pursuing a career in quantitative trading or hedge fund management.
- Data Mining for Finance: Learn how to use data mining techniques to extract valuable insights from financial data. This course covers topics such as data cleaning, feature selection, and model building. You'll develop the skills to identify patterns, predict trends, and detect anomalies in financial data. This knowledge is essential for anyone pursuing a career in financial analysis, risk management, or fraud detection.
Are you guys thinking about diving into the world of finance and computer science at the University of Sydney (USYD)? Well, you're in the right place! Combining these two fields is like creating the ultimate power couple in the tech and business world. Let’s break down why studying finance and computer science at USYD could be an awesome move for your future.
Why Finance and Computer Science?
So, why exactly should you consider merging these two seemingly different worlds? Finance relies heavily on data analysis, algorithmic trading, and cybersecurity, while computer science provides the tools and knowledge to tackle these challenges head-on. Think about it: every major financial institution is now a tech company at heart. They need experts who understand both the language of money and the language of machines.
The Synergy Between Finance and Computer Science
Computer science brings a quantitative and analytical approach to finance. You'll learn how to build models, analyze vast datasets, and automate complex processes. In today's financial landscape, where high-frequency trading and complex algorithms dominate, having a strong grasp of computer science is not just an advantage—it's a necessity. You'll be equipped to develop new financial products, assess risk more accurately, and even predict market trends using machine learning techniques.
Furthermore, computer science skills are crucial for financial security. As cyber threats become more sophisticated, the finance industry needs experts who can protect sensitive data and prevent fraud. By studying computer science, you'll gain the skills to build secure systems, detect anomalies, and respond effectively to cyberattacks. This is an area of growing importance, and graduates with expertise in both finance and computer science are highly sought after.
The Growing Demand in the Job Market
Let's be real, job prospects are a big deal. The demand for professionals with expertise in both finance and computer science is skyrocketing. Companies are looking for individuals who can bridge the gap between these two disciplines. Whether it's developing cutting-edge trading algorithms, creating secure payment systems, or analyzing market data to inform investment decisions, the opportunities are endless. With a background in both finance and computer science, you'll be well-positioned to land a high-paying job in a variety of industries, from investment banking to fintech startups.
Moreover, the skills you gain from studying finance and computer science are highly transferable. Even if you decide to pursue a career outside of traditional finance, such as in data science or consulting, your knowledge of financial principles and computational techniques will be invaluable. You'll be able to approach complex problems from a quantitative perspective, develop innovative solutions, and communicate your findings effectively. In today's data-driven world, these skills are in high demand across a wide range of industries.
Why USYD? The University of Sydney Advantage
Okay, so you're digging the idea of combining finance and computer science. Why should you choose USYD? Well, USYD isn't just any university; it's a powerhouse of academic excellence and innovation. Let's explore what makes USYD a top choice for studying these dynamic fields.
Reputation and Rankings
USYD consistently ranks among the top universities in the world. Its finance and computer science departments are highly regarded, attracting leading researchers and academics. Studying at a prestigious institution like USYD can open doors to internships, research opportunities, and job prospects that you might not find elsewhere. Employers recognize the value of a USYD degree, and graduates are highly sought after in the global job market. This reputation extends beyond Australia, making a USYD degree a valuable asset wherever your career takes you.
The university's commitment to excellence is reflected in its research output and teaching quality. USYD faculty members are actively engaged in cutting-edge research, pushing the boundaries of knowledge in both finance and computer science. As a student, you'll have the opportunity to learn from these experts, participate in research projects, and contribute to the advancement of knowledge in your chosen field. This hands-on experience can be invaluable in preparing you for a successful career.
Course Structure and Flexibility
USYD offers a range of programs that allow you to combine finance and computer science. Whether you choose a double degree or a major/minor combination, you'll have the flexibility to tailor your studies to your interests and career goals. The curriculum is designed to provide a solid foundation in both disciplines, with opportunities to specialize in areas such as financial modeling, algorithmic trading, or cybersecurity. This flexibility allows you to create a unique academic profile that sets you apart from other graduates.
Furthermore, USYD's course structure is designed to promote interdisciplinary learning. You'll have the opportunity to take courses from different departments, collaborate with students from diverse backgrounds, and gain a broad perspective on the challenges and opportunities facing the finance and computer science industries. This interdisciplinary approach can help you develop a more holistic understanding of the world and prepare you for leadership roles in your chosen field.
Resources and Opportunities
USYD boasts state-of-the-art facilities, including advanced computer labs, financial data centers, and research libraries. You'll have access to the latest software, databases, and analytical tools, allowing you to conduct cutting-edge research and develop innovative solutions. The university also offers a range of extracurricular activities, such as coding clubs, finance societies, and hackathons, providing opportunities to network with peers, learn new skills, and showcase your talents. These resources and opportunities can enhance your learning experience and prepare you for a successful career.
Moreover, USYD has strong ties to the finance and technology industries, providing students with access to internships, industry projects, and networking events. You'll have the opportunity to gain real-world experience, build connections with industry professionals, and explore potential career paths. These connections can be invaluable in helping you launch your career after graduation.
What to Expect in the Courses
Alright, let's get down to the nitty-gritty. What kind of courses can you expect when you combine finance and computer science at USYD? Here’s a sneak peek.
Core Finance Courses
You’ll dive into the fundamentals of finance, including corporate finance, investments, and financial markets. Expect to learn about valuation techniques, risk management, and portfolio optimization. These courses will provide you with a solid understanding of how financial institutions operate and how investment decisions are made. You'll also learn about the role of finance in the global economy and the challenges facing the financial industry.
Core Computer Science Courses
Get ready to code! You'll cover programming fundamentals, data structures, algorithms, and software engineering. These courses will equip you with the technical skills to build software applications, analyze data, and solve complex problems. You'll also learn about the principles of software design, testing, and maintenance. These skills are essential for anyone pursuing a career in computer science, whether it's developing new software, analyzing data, or managing IT systems.
Interdisciplinary Courses
This is where the magic happens. You'll take courses that bridge the gap between finance and computer science, such as financial modeling, algorithmic trading, and data mining for finance. These courses will allow you to apply your computer science skills to solve real-world financial problems. You'll also learn about the ethical and regulatory issues surrounding the use of technology in finance.
Career Paths After Graduation
Okay, so you've aced your courses and you're ready to conquer the world. What kind of jobs can you get with a finance and computer science degree from USYD? Let's explore some exciting career paths.
Quantitative Analyst (Quant)
Quants develop and implement mathematical and statistical models to solve financial problems. They work in areas such as pricing derivatives, managing risk, and developing trading strategies. Your computer science skills will be crucial for building and testing these models, while your finance knowledge will help you understand the underlying financial concepts.
Data Scientist
Data scientists analyze large datasets to identify trends, patterns, and insights. In the finance industry, they might work on fraud detection, customer segmentation, or risk management. Your computer science skills will be essential for collecting, cleaning, and analyzing data, while your finance knowledge will help you interpret the results and make informed recommendations.
Fintech Innovator
Fintech is a rapidly growing industry that combines finance and technology to create innovative financial products and services. You could work for a fintech startup or a large financial institution, developing new payment systems, lending platforms, or investment tools. Your computer science skills will be essential for building these technologies, while your finance knowledge will help you understand the financial industry and identify opportunities for innovation.
Software Engineer in Finance
Financial institutions need skilled software engineers to develop and maintain their trading systems, risk management platforms, and other critical applications. You could work on developing high-performance trading systems, building secure payment platforms, or creating sophisticated risk management tools. Your computer science skills will be essential for designing, coding, and testing these systems, while your finance knowledge will help you understand the financial context and requirements.
Final Thoughts
Combining finance and computer science at USYD is a fantastic way to set yourself up for a successful and rewarding career. You'll gain a unique skill set that is highly valued by employers in the finance and technology industries. So, if you're passionate about both finance and computer science, USYD could be the perfect place for you to pursue your dreams. Just remember to stay curious, work hard, and never stop learning!
Lastest News
-
-
Related News
Activate Your SCNBPSC ATM Card: A Simple Guide
Alex Braham - Nov 12, 2025 46 Views -
Related News
Kia Sportage Hybrid EX Vs SX: Which Is Better?
Alex Braham - Nov 13, 2025 46 Views -
Related News
Blazers Vs. Warriors: How To Watch The NBA Game Live
Alex Braham - Nov 9, 2025 52 Views -
Related News
Vinicius Junior: The Rising Star Of Brazilian Football
Alex Braham - Nov 9, 2025 54 Views -
Related News
Liga Puerto Rico: All About The Baseball League
Alex Braham - Nov 9, 2025 47 Views